Saltar para o conteúdo principal
Versão: 20 R7 BETA

PHP SET OPTION

PHP SET OPTION ( opçao ; valor {; *} )

ParâmetroTipoDescrição
opçaoIntegerOpção a ser estabelecida
valorBooleanNovo valor da opção
*OperadorSe passado: modificação apenas se aplica à próxima chamada

Esse comando não é seguro para thread e não pode ser usado em código adequado.

Compatibilidade

PHP está obsoleto em 4D. Recomenda-se usar a classe 4D.SystemWorker class.

Descrição

O comando PHP SET OPTION se utiliza para definir opções específicas antes de chamar o comando PHP Execute. O escopo deste comando é o processo atual.

Passe no parâmetro opção uma constante do tema "PHP" para designar a opção a modificar e no parâmetro valor, o novo valor da opção. Esta é uma descrição das opções:

ConstanteTipoValorComentário
PHP raw resultInteiro longo2Definição do modo de processamento dos cabeçalhos HTTP devolvidos por PHP no resultado da execução quando este resultado for do tipo Texto (quando o resultado for do tipo BLOB, os cabeçalhos são mantidos sempre).
Valores possíveis: Booleano: False (valor padrão = eliminar os cabeçalhos HTTP do resultado. True = conservar os cabeçalhos HTTP.

Como padrão, PHP SET OPTION define a opção para todas as chamadas a PHP Execute posteriores do processo. Se quiser definir para a próxima chamada unicamente passe o parâmetro estrela (*).

Ver também

PHP Execute
PHP GET OPTION